GEFONT wants to see govt fixed pay scale applied
Kantipur Report
KATHMANDU, Nov 12 - General Federation of Nepalese Trade Unions (GEFONT) on Wednesday urged business organisations to implement the basic salary fixed by the government.GEFONT further asked the government to review the basic salary and drew the attention of the authorities concerned towards the organisations that have ...
The recently held national committee meeting of GEFONT asked the business organisations not to fix the monthly salary below Rs. 4,600 and daily wages below Rs. 190.
the of trade unions affiliated to the CPN-UML GEFONT urged the bodies concerned to send the list of industries and organisations that have not increased the salary within 15 days.
Meanwhile, GEFONT"which has more than two dozens of federations that cover different sectors including manufacturing, carpet industry, transport, hotels, restaurants and catering, and tourism among other"asked the stakeholders to inform it about the industries and organisations that have not increased the salary within 15 days.
